  1. 4 dni temu · Key takeaways: Reach-in vs. walk-in closets offer different storage options. Standard closet rod height is 60 inches for single-rod systems. Adjustments for double-rod systems and children’s closets. Minimum closet depth is 24 inches, 28 inches for bulky items. Space between rods and shelves is crucial for functionality.   2. 4 dni temu · If considering a walk-in closet, aim for a minimum width of 6.5 feet. This allows for hanging space on one wall and shelves or drawers opposite, ensuring there’s enough room to stand and dress comfortably.

  7. 5 dni temu · The formula to calculate wall area is simple and direct: \[ WA = WL \times WH \] where: \(WA\) represents the Wall Area in square feet (\(ft^2\)), \(WL\) is the Wall Length in feet (\(ft\)), \(WH\) is the Wall Height in feet (\(ft\)). Example Calculation. Suppose you have a wall that is 10 feet long and 8 feet high. Using the formula:
